    Originally posted by ImAnOlogist
    Having issues with starting out really strong, I rock my opponent about 5 times or more and can't of course capitalize on the rock due to the mechanics at this state, the opponent in say the 2nd or 3rd round puts me out with one punch and finishes me. It's such a disappointment, I get anything can happen, should we be disengaging completely when we get a rock to conserve and avoid that random counter ? are we expected to win entirely by decisions unless the luck happens to be in our favor ?
    When you have someone rocked and they block, throw 3 straight punches and then one hook or opposite, 3 hooks and one straight. This will break their guard and increase your chances of finishing the fight.
